About 1500 Wiley Lewis Rd

188.75+/- acres in Guilford County. Best use of property would be residential development. This property is in a Tier 2 watershed with access to water and sewer. The sewer access is on the property. Land is level to gently rolling and mostly wooded w/ a creek in the middle. An abundance of space for residential lots and common areas. Greensboro fire services cover this property. There is an access point with road frontage off Stonebrook Farm Rd. could be a great way to add single family homes to an existing neighborhood. There is also an access point with high visibility and road frontage on Wiley Lewis Rd. that offers a variety of opportunities for use.

Living in Greensboro, NC

Transportation in Greensboro is facilitated by a network of roads and highways that connect the city to the wider region. Public transit options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The city is also making strides in enhancing walkability and bikeability, particularly in the downtown area and other key neighborhoods. While specific ride-sharing services are operational in Greensboro, the city encourages the use of various modes of transportation to reduce congestion and promote environmental sustainability.

Residents of Greensboro have access to a comprehensive array of services. The educational system includes numerous public and private schools, catering to all levels of education, from elementary to high school. Healthcare facilities are well-distributed throughout the city, offering a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The public library system is extensive, supporting the community's educational and informational needs. Retail and dining options are plentiful, showcasing both national chains and local establishments that reflect the city's diverse cultural palate.

Greensboro prides itself on being a vibrant community with a rich historical backdrop. The city is celebrated for its well-preserved historical districts and the annual events that reflect its cultural heritage. The community's character is further defined by its green spaces and public parks, which provide residents with ample opportunities for outdoor activities and relaxation.

The housing landscape in Greensboro is diverse, offering a mix of single-family homes, apartments, and townhouses to accommodate a range of preferences. Architectural styles vary, with a prevalence of traditional and colonial homes alongside more contemporary designs. The market is primarily composed of single-family homes, with a substantial portion of residences built during the late 20th century. The homeownership rate in Greensboro is robust, with a significant majority of residents owning their homes, while the remainder are engaged in the rental market.
